  • Its really good, I was doubtful because of its location and because there are so many choices in Las Vegas and wow, this place is amazing. I know the line is long but its definitely worth the 1 hour-ish wait. After our first try, we came here three night in a row to have more of the amazing food. This is definitely nothing fancy as Guy Savoy, but it is definitely authentic Southern style seafood. I love this type of no frill food joint. Just good food without the expensive tag. During our visits, I tried most of the items on the menu. First off, you get to pick level 1 to 10 for your food's spicyness. I go for 1 or 0 simply because I dont' like spicy food. The dinner roll is complimentary, and it is the standard sourdough roll, served warm with butter. Their Clam Chowder is actually not that good, too powdery taste. I don't know why others liked it, I didn't. Not enough clam in it too. I like Boudin's Clam Chowder better when compare to similiar level. Their Bouillabaisse is good, you can choose between rice or noodle, it is tomato based soup with all of the seafoods (Lobster, Crab, Shrimp, Clams, Mussels, Fish..etc), which is their #2 signature item. #1 most popular item is their combo roast. It is thicker in terms of broth, but it goes really well with rice. You get to pick your favorite toppings but combo roast comes with shrimp, crab, and lobster, which is better in my opinion than the Palace Roast (with chicken). Its little bit spicy for me but the bold taste of the seafood is one of the best I had for years. My personal favorite goes to the Shrimp Scampi with Pasta. Its the clam soup with melted butter and loads of tiger shrimp. Its so heavenly. I would order extra noodle next time when I go to satisfy my crave. Tip: There's no tip as in when the lines will be shorter, its really your luck but the chef really matters alot. Even the materials/ingredients are all the same, but chef really made the difference. During our 3 visits, this fat chef whose always happy did the best job. His shrimp scampi is out of this world yet another chef always seems piss at something...did a very sloppy job, my scampi was dry and soup-less. Good luck waiting and don't lose too much money on slots while waiting in line!
